Leister doesn’t tease users with new versions each year and instead produces new versions every three or four years, so the cost does average out. And Leister Productions, the maker of Reunion, has a video on making the transition to 10 available.Īnd of course, Leister is never prone to discounts, so a new license is $99 USD and an upgrade from any previous version is $49.95 USD.
